The president has nominated the next ambassador to Canada. What must happen before the ambassador can take office?
ELEN [110]

To answer your question on What must happen before the ambassador can take office? Their appointment needs to be confirmed by the United States Senate. An ambassador can be appointed during a recess, but he or she can only serve as ambassador until the end of the next session of Congress unless subsequently confirmed.
